Output 58cfd107f82bb42ebc8bf5e23dfdff02e8a52d68f458ea5e0ec860145e8fa48e:24

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c0a02b3befbb83c97f1a00b927adf08a522620d3599e0a34819681fa4861e6b
address
bc1p8s9q9va7lwure9l35q9ey7klpzjjycsdxkv7pg6gr95plfyxre4skdaxjl
transaction
58cfd107f82bb42ebc8bf5e23dfdff02e8a52d68f458ea5e0ec860145e8fa48e
spent
true